TurnKey Linux Virtual Appliance Library

New TurnKey CodeIgniter version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ey CodeIgniter.
  • Includes TurnKey Web Control panel with links to useful references, and relevant path information (convenience).
  • Regenerates all secrets during installation / firstboot (security).
  • Preconfigured MySQL database and user for codeignite (convenience).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
    • Includes PhpMyAdmin (listening on port 12322 - uses SSL).
  • SSL support out of the box.
  • Includes php-xcache PHP opcode cacher / optimizer (performance).
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

codeigniter 2.1.1 (upstream archive)
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Collabtive version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ey Collabtive.
  • Set Collabtive admin password and email on firstboot (convenience, security).
  • Regenerates all secrets during installation / firstboot (security).
  • Removed language: et (bugfix).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
    • Includes PhpMyAdmin (listening on port 12322 - uses SSL).
  • SSL support out of the box.
  • Includes php-xcache PHP opcode cacher / optimizer (performance).
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

collabtive 0.7.6 (upstream archive)
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Concrete5 version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ey Concrete5, based on TKLPatch submitted by Jeremy Davis.
  • Set Concrete5 admin password and email on firstboot (convenience, security).
  • Regenerates all secrets during installation / firstboot (security).
  • Pretty URL's enabled out of the box (convenience, SEO).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
    • Includes PhpMyAdmin (listening on port 12322 - uses SSL).
  • SSL support out of the box.
  • Includes php-xcache PHP opcode cacher / optimizer (performance).
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

concrete5 5.2.1 (upstream archive)
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Core version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Upgraded base distribution to Debian Squeeze 6.0.5.
    • Support for dependency based boot sequence (insserv).
    • Default ISO Kernel 2.6-686 (TKL Core Lenny was 486).
  • TKLBAM (backup and migration):
    • Upgraded to latest version of TKLBAM (see changelog for details, below are some of the highlights).
    • Added embedded squid download cache support.
    • Added backup resume functionality.
    • Added support for multipart parallel uploads to S3.
    • Upgraded duplicity and python-boto.
    • Multipart parallel S3 uploads.
    • Fixed root cause of MySQL max packet issue (bugfix).
  • Installer (di-live):
    • Upgraded di-live to latest version compatible with Squeeze.
    • Misc bugfixes and tweaks.
  • Boot (bootsplash and grub):
    • Upgraded bootsplash generation to be compatible with Squeeze.
    • Removed bootsplash unused panel options and extraneous files.
    • Tweaked grub default timeouts (hidden_timeout=0, timeout=3).
  • Locale:
    • Set default locale to en_US.UTF-8 (was en_GB).
    • Updated locale configuration for compatibility with Squeeze.
    • Includes localepurge (pre-configured and initialized).
  • Web management console (webmin):
    • Upgraded webmin to 1.590 and default theme.
    • Disabled inline webmin upgrades (managed by APT).
    • Moved history logging to /var/webmin (incorrect use of /etc).
  • Web shell (shellinabox):
    • Upgraded shellinabox to 2.14.
  • Bugfixes and tweaks:
    • Fixed LSB compatibility (di-live, inithooks, confconsole) [LP#700399].
    • Added support for spaces in bashrc promptpath [LP#932388].
    • Replaced APT trusted.db with trusted.gpg.d/$distro.
    • Added bashmarks (super useful bash bookmarking).
    • Removal of log files generated during build.
    • inithooks: Improved headless deployment (REDIRECT_OUTPUT directive).
    • etckeeper: Uninitialization post build and firstboot (turnkey-init).
    • resolvconf: Removed upstart hack (not relevant on Squeeze).
    • confconsole: Miscallaneous bugfixes and refactoring.
    • install-security-updates: Wrapper script for convenience.

Links

New TurnKey Canvas version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ey Canvas.
  • Canvas related:
    • Canvas LMS and nodejs installed from latest upstream version. Redis server installed from Squeeze backports as required.
    • Set Canvas admin password and email on firstboot (convenience, security).
    • Set Canvas domain to serve on first boot (convenience).
    • Pre-configured to use MySQL (recommended for production).
    • Includes Canvas automated jobs daemon initscript (disabled by default).
    • Includes Apache pre-configured with passenger support, with SSL support out of the box (performance, security).
  • Regenerates all secrets during installation / firstboot (security).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

canvas-lms revision db0034c (upstream archive)
rails 2.3.14
ruby-enterprise 1.8.7-2012.02
ruby 4.5
ruby-dev 4.5
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
redis-server 2.4.15-1~bpo60+2 (backported package)
build-essential 11.5
imagemagick 8:6.6.0.4-3+squeeze3

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ey CakePHP version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ey CakePHP.
  • Includes TurnKey Web Control panel with links to useful references, relevant path information, and CakePHP checks (convenience).
  • Regenerates all secrets during installation / firstboot (security).
  • Preconfigured MySQL database and user for CakePHP (convenience).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
    • Includes PhpMyAdmin (listening on port 12322 - uses SSL).
  • SSL support out of the box.
  • Includes php-xcache PHP opcode cacher / optimizer (performance).
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

cakephp 2.2.1-0 (upstream archive)
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Bugzilla version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Bugzilla:
    • Upgraded to latest upstream package.
    • Generation of site-wide-secret on firstboot (security).
    • Set default email language to English (LP#918476).
    • Added required libraries to display line and bar charts (LP#927499).
    • Added extra optional packages for more out-of-the-box functionality.

Major component versions

bugzilla3 3.6.2.0-4.5
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ey BambooInvoice version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ey BambooInvoice.
  • Set BambooInvoice admin password, email and domain to serve on firstboot (convenience, security).
  • Regenerates all secrets during installation / firstboot (security).
  • MySQL related:
    • Set MySQL root password on firstboot (convenience, security).
    • Force MySQL to use Unicode/UTF8.
    • Includes PhpMyAdmin (listening on port 12322 - uses SSL).
  • SSL support out of the box.
  • Includes php-xcache PHP opcode cacher / optimizer (performance).
  • Includes postfix MTA (bound to localhost) for sending of email (e.g. password recovery). Also includes webmin postfix module for convenience.

Major component versions

bambooinvoice 0.8.9 (upstream archive)
apache2 2.2.16-6+squeeze7
mysql-server 5.1.63-0+squeeze1
phpmyadmin 4:3.3.7-7

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Appengine Java version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ey Linux AppEngine Java.
  • Google AppEngine (Java-SDK) support:
    • ANT to build java applications.
    • Google Web Toolkit (GWT).
  • Includes TurnKey Web Control panel with useful information, references, and link to offline documentation (convenience).
  • Regenerates all secrets during installation / firstboot (security).

Major component versions

appengine-java-sdk 1.6.5
google-appengine-docs 20120228
gwt 2.4.0
openjdk-6-jdk 6b18-1.8.13-0+squeeze2
openjdk-6-jre 6b18-1.8.13-0+squeeze2
ant 1.8.0-4
lighttpd 1.4.28-2+squeeze1
postfix 2.7.1-1+squeeze1

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links

New TurnKey Appengine Python version (12.0)

Thu, 2012/08/30 - 09:24

Changes:

  • Initial public release of TurnKey Linux AppEngine Python.
  • Google App Engine configurations
    • Preconfigured cgi, webapp and django appengine application templates - /var/www/appengine/template-*
    • Template-Django is preconfigured for NoSQL: - http://www.allbuttonspressed.com/projects/djangoappengine
    • Includes welcome page with useful information and link to offline documentation.
  • Includes TurnKey Web Control panel with useful information, references, and link to offline documentation (convenience).
  • Regenerates all secrets during installation / firstboot (security).
  • Includes python imaging library (PIL) for appengine Image API.

Major component versions

google_appengine 1.6.5
google-appengine-docs 20120228
template-django pulled from upstream repo: 2012-05-03
antlr_python_runtime 3.1.3
lighttpd 1.4.28-2+squeeze1
postfix 2.7.1-1+squeeze1
python-imaging 1.1.7-2

Note: Please refer to turnkey-core's changelog for changes common to all appliances. Here we only describe changes specific to this appliance.

Links